What drives eviction risk in Jennings Lodge
The score leans hardest on local political climate at 8.3/10. Severe burden reaches 22%. Those are renters paying half their income or more, and that is where non-payment filings originate. Running hot, rent-regulation exposure reads 8.1/10.
On the softer side, supply constraint reads 2.4/10. Average gross rent is $1,468, 16% below the Gladstone average. Court records carry 169 eviction filings across 6 observed years.
Filings peaked in 2009 at 5.9% of renter households. In a typical year about 4.0% of renter households face a filing.
Nationally it ranks #9,433 of 84,120 for landlord eviction difficulty. On the CDC Social Vulnerability Index the tract reads 8.1/10, which tracks how hard a shock lands on the households already here.
Statewide the OR average is 6.1, so this tract runs 1.6 points hotter. Of its three components the household composition measure is the most pressured.
52% of renter households spend at least 30% of income on rent. Annual rent works out to 24% of average household income of $74,148.
